Chemical properties describe how things undergo chemical reactions, while physical properties describe how things behave when they're not undergoing reactions.
In the case of melting a metal, the melted metal continues to be the same material - just in a liquid rather than a solid form. As a result, melting (and all phase changes, for that matter) is a physical change and the ability of the metal to melt at 450 degrees is a physical property.

The answer is: Dividing the number of molecules in the sample by Avogadro's number.
The Avogadro’s number is the number of atoms in 12 grams of the isotope carbon-12 (¹²C).
Na is Avogadro number or Avogadro constant (the number of particles, in this example carbon, that are contained in the amount of substance given by one mole).
The Avogadro number has value 6.022·10²³ 1/mol in the International System of Units; Na = 6.022·10²³ 1/mol.
